Screen Diagonal Measurement

The most common and arguably most visually perceptible measure is the screen’s diagonal length. This is typically expressed in inches (e.g., 13.3", 15.6", 17.3"). Manufacturers and retailers often primarily use this value to categorize laptops. This does not, however, encompass the entire device’s physical measurements or functionality.

Physical Dimensions (Length, Width, Depth)

Beyond the screen, critical physical measurements include length, width, and depth. These are often listed in millimeters (mm) or inches, and significantly affect the laptop’s ergonomic properties and portability:

  • Length: The horizontal measurement from the leftmost to the rightmost edge of the laptop.
  • Width: The vertical dimension from the top to the bottom of the device.
  • Depth: The measurement from the front to the back of the machine.

Weighing the Device

Weight is another crucial aspect of measuring laptops, usually expressed in grams (g) or ounces (oz). Laptop weight directly impacts usability and portability. A lighter laptop often translates to better handling and easier transport. The weight, in conjunction with dimensions, greatly informs a user’s experience with a particular device.

Variations and Standards

It’s important to note that there aren’t standardized measurement methodologies for laptops across different manufacturers. While most use common units, variations might exist within each manufacturer’s specification sheets. Retailers might also provide additional dimensions depending upon the intended sales area/territory.

Distinction between stated and actual measures

The stated specifications on manufacturer websites might sometimes differ from the actual measurements. Careful examination of dimensions, comparison with similar models across various sites, and even personal measurements with a measuring tape are crucial to forming an accurate perception of a laptop’s size.

Impact of Configuration on Dimensions

Configuration, such as the presence of an optical drive, specific cooling configurations, or premium materials used in construction, influence overall dimensions and weight. A laptop with a dedicated graphics card or more powerful processors will, for example, often come with a substantial increase in weight and bulk.
